ARRAY LIST


INSTRUCTIONS TO RUN THE PROGRAM

  1. Run "./a.out" file.

  2. The entries in the file are already inserted into the array.

  3. The program is MENU-DRIVEN so you can appropriately operate on the array doing the operations that you want to do. e.g.->search,delete,sort,display,etc.


COMPONENTS OF THE FOLDER

  1. "input.txt" file contains all the entries alongwith the number of entries on the

    top.

  2. "personclasshelpers.h" is a user defined directory in which the class person is implemented.

  3. "personarrayclasshelpers.h" is a user defined directory in which the class personarray is implemented.

  4. "personarr.cpp" contains the main function.

  5. "./a.out" contains the compiled file compiled using g++ compiler.


TIME COMPLEXITIES

1) Class Person

Person()->

      O(1)

      complexity as 2 strings(of max length 15) are copied alongwith age of person.

Person(char fname[], char lname[], int a)->

      O(1)

      complexity as 2 strings(of max length 15) are copied alongwith age of person.

void display()->

      O(1)

      complexity as name and age are printed which take constant number of steps.

string getName()->

      O(1)

      complexity as firstname and lastname are max 15 length so takes constant number of steps.

int getAge()->

      O(1)

      complexity as returns age which takes constant number of steps.

void setAge()->

      O(1)

      complexity as sets age which takes constant number of steps.

void setName()->

      O(1)

      complexity as sets name(2 strings of max 15 length) which takes constant number of steps.

bool operator<(Person p)->

      O(1)

      complexity as takes constant number of steps to compare ages and firstnames(if ages are equal).

bool operator>(Person p)->

      O(1)

      complexity as takes constant number of steps to compare ages and firstnames(if ages are equal).

bool operator==(Person p)->

      O(1)

      complexity as takes constant number of steps to compare ages(if equal).

2) Class PersonArray

PersonArray()->

      O(1)

      complexity as takes constant number of steps to initialize length.

void insertElementAtIndex(int index, Person element)->

      O(n)  [n=length of array]

      complexity as in worst case all the elements have to be shifted forward by 1.

void deleteElementAtIndex(int index)->

      O(n)  [n=length of array]

      complexity as in worst case all the elements have to be shifted backward by 1.

void display()->

      O(n)   [n=length of the array]

      complexity as all n elements inserted have to be displayed and displaying each element takes

      constant number of steps.

void sort()->

      O(n^2)     [n=length of the array]

      complexity as bubble sort takes n^2 time in the worst case(when the array is in decending

      order).

void searchForElement(Person p)->

      O(n)     [n-length of the array]

      complexity as in the worst case doesn't find the element after going through all the elements.
